Narita International Airport Corporation , abbreviated NAA, is a parastatal company responsible for the management of Narita International Airport in Japan. It is the successor to the New Tokyo International Airport Authority which was established on 30 July 1966. NAA was privatized on April 1, 2004.

Corinthian Island is a former island in the San Francisco Bay, that was later attached to the mainland. It is in Marin County, California, by the Tiburon Peninsula. Its coordinates are 37°52′22″N 122°27′32″W, and the United States Geological Survey gave its elevation as 72 ft (22 m) in 1981. It appears on a 1950 USGS map of the area.
